This is a challenging time of year for dog owners that are distracted while walking their dogs. Texting, scrolling social media, or any other distraction that takes away your focus from your dog can mean the difference between returning home safely with your dog or them possibly running away.
I always suggest to my dog clients to also attach an AirTag or comparable tracker to their dog’s collar or harness. They just came out with the next generation AirTag that can help track a lost pet at a greater distance, so updating to the new version is highly worth it!
The Smells of Spring Can Lead Dogs Into Danger
As spring arrives, the world comes alive with new scents — blooming flowers, wildlife, fresh earth… and for our dogs, it’s irresistible.
But following their nose can quickly turn into trouble.
Every year, we see an increase in lost dogs this time of year.
A slipped collar.
A door left open for just a second.
A dog that’s never run before… suddenly gone.
And within moments — they are in survival mode.
This is one of the highest risk seasons for lost dogs.
Please take extra precautions:
Double check collars and harnesses before every walk
Always use a leash — even in “safe” areas
Be mindful during dawn and dusk when wildlife is active
Never assume your dog won’t run
One scent.
One moment.
One decision.
That’s all it takes.
Keeping your dog safe starts before they go missing.
Let’s keep them home this spring.
